Runbook: Address autocomplete widget (Plottery). If suggestions stop loading, check the Nexhollow geocode cache first — a cold cache causes 5–10s delays, not outages. Blank dropdowns usually mean the rate limiter tripped; reset via the admin panel, not a redeploy. Escalate only if errors persist past 15 minutes. When filing an escalation, quote the widget build token below.

session token of kageg-tahop = htk14_af3c1ccccb7dcf

## Releases

Nightfold (our nightly backfill scheduler) cuts a release whenever the backfill DAG format changes — so, roughly monthly. Tag from main, let the Copperline pipeline build the bundle, and smoke-test against the staging warehouse before promoting. Heads up: the scheduler won't pick up new job specs until you bump the manifest version, which people forget constantly. Releases must be signed or agents will refuse the bundle. Sign with the release key shown below.

deploy key for yahag-kawip: bky9_VGNU8B7oS

When your plugin registers with the Fennmark metrics sidecar, be aware that each emitter consumes a fixed slice of the aggregation buffer. The sidecar flushes on a rolling window, so bursty plugins can starve quieter ones if you exceed the documented cardinality ceiling. Please size your label sets conservatively and test against the Harrowgate staging cluster before release. Capacity is provisioned from the constants below, so treat them as hard limits rather than suggestions.

limits module of kawef-hawef:
TIERS = {
    "belax": 967,
    "gorvan": 210,
    "ulair": 473,
}

## Authentication

The Stallwatch occupancy feed (live counts from the Brindlemoor garage sensors) won't give you anything without a key — not even the health endpoint, which is annoying but intentional. Pass the key in the `X-Stallwatch-Auth` header on every request. Tokens rotate quarterly, so if you're on call and suddenly seeing 401s across the board, rotation is the first thing to check before paging the platform folks. The current key for the internal feed is below.

service key, fawip-bajef: kto11_Qt5wZK9vdNC